ECONOMIC EVALUATION OF THE CHEK2 GENOTYPING AND PERSONALIZED BREAST CANCER SCREENING IN THE POLISH HEALTH CARE SYSTEM

OBJECTIVES: The assessment of economic implications, both for individualized breast cancer (BC)  prevention and for public health policy, of findings concerning the risk of BC cancer in women with CHEK2 heterozygosity METHODS: Cost-effectiveness analysis of genotyping every women at CHEK2 and offering – on the basis of her BC risk profile - a personalized screening programme in which the starting age would vary, versus  present strategy, was perfomed using modelling  technique. Two scenarios were compared: (A) DNA CHEK2 test in  all women, screening strategy beginning at 25 years of age only in CHEK2-positive women (1.2%) and standard screening strategy (beginning at 50 years) in the remained population; (B) without DNA CHEK2 test,  in all women standard screening strategy. Data on life expectancy, BC risk, efficacy of screening strategy and medical costs were obtained from published literatures. The cohort simulation started with 25-year-old women and projected direct medical costs and outcomes  over patients lifetimes. Effectiveness was measured as life years gained (LYG). Only direct medical costs (BC screening and treatment) were included, assessed from health care payer perspective and reported in PLN (1 EUR=4.5 PLN in 2009). 5% and 3.5% discount rate was used for cost and effectiveness, respectively.  RESULTS: The total lifetime costs/patient  were estimated to be  2223.85 PLN (discounted: 644.84 PLN) in (A) and 1998.20 PLN (discounted : 430.15 PLN) in (B). The total LYG generated with scenario (A) were 50.958 vs. 50,939 with scenario (B) (without discounting) and 23,170 vs. 23,165 (discounted), respectively. This results in ICER for (A) of 11,862 PLN/LYG (without discounting) and 41,865 PLN/LYG (discounted). Results were robust to sensitivity analyses. CONCLUSIONS: The use of CHEK2genotyping and pesonalized BC screening improves survival compared to standard strategy and considering the suggested threshold for cost-effectiveness in Poland (80,000 PLN/LYG in 2008), is  cost-effective in the Polish health-care system.
